Output 266b27050dd3bc836e7b20b6c7100494194b27f186e661c4ca48d6dbae53e0ee:1

value
2365731
script pubkey
OP_0 OP_PUSHBYTES_20 7472ab88a6bfd5aeb924502f21ff4608e95121f4
address
bc1qw3e2hz9xhl26awfy2qhjrl6xpr54zg058zvacn
transaction
266b27050dd3bc836e7b20b6c7100494194b27f186e661c4ca48d6dbae53e0ee
confirmations
157052
spent
true